A little information from a regular toyota here. Locally people generalized ae111 all together, for you to know first variant it's actually ae110 year 1996-1997, the actual ae111 ranged from 1998 to 2002. (Off the record ae111 with 4AGE still in production up to 2006 in South African).

So i can roughly tell you once you know the right person to go for, parts are actually widely available.

With 18k, you can find ae111 with 4age ready. With 20k you most find came along some aftermarket, jdm/usdm/euro whatever converted kit.

An alternative is getting stock ae111 and swap for 2zzge. Lovely NA 1.8 from zzt231. Lotus Exige adopted similar engine :) An easier to squeeze horses engine rather than 4age.

Turbo ey ? I do know local who slap 600whp on a 4agte. Anyway that does not suit your perfect balance(price/maintenance/performance/fuel)

Quite numerous adjustable service around, mostly will tell you first "TEIN SERVICE available" i do find this local mentality to worship Tein. Outcome of servicing relies on two things, their workmanship of re-installation and choices of gas for absorber. But of course, i could name you places depending which shock maker you have.
